Versatility and Range of Applications

One of the strongest selling points of the Free Shipping Crawler Big Excavator series is its versatility. These machines can be adapted for a wide range of tasks with compatible attachments. Standard buckets are ideal for excavation and material transport, while specialized attachments such as hammers, grapples, and quick couplers allow for demolition, site preparation, and handling heavy or awkward loads.

The ability to switch attachments quickly ensures minimal downtime between tasks, which is crucial on fast-paced construction sites. The versatility of these excavators makes them suitable not just for construction, but also for forestry, landscaping, infrastructure projects, and mining operations.

Safety Features for Operator and Site Protection

Safety is a primary concern in the design of these excavators. Reinforced cab structures provide protection in the event of rollovers or falling debris. Anti-slip steps and handrails ensure operators can safely enter and exit the machine.

Advanced safety systems, including emergency stop functions, alarms, and visibility enhancements, help prevent accidents. Large windows and strategically placed mirrors improve operator visibility, reducing blind spots during operations. These safety measures are crucial for compliance with occupational safety standards and protecting personnel on busy construction sites.
